Output 93c56963ad3f17b0c0cd52458ac45914198351a487c384d643ea307efc659694:0
- value
- 20489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4fbfed529600a308e22cfe5d008137d128b2958e OP_EQUAL
- address
- 38xhE2HYyaCHEUkyLxadAX66snmfue3XPc
- transaction
- 93c56963ad3f17b0c0cd52458ac45914198351a487c384d643ea307efc659694